The Western Australia / Perth Metro Area
For those who know the Mediterranean, Perth's climate is not unlike the weather there, long dry summers and mild, rainy winters. Perth is the capital of Western Australia, Australia's largest state but least populated state. Perth is modern and fairly new city, very few skyscrapers and bordered by the Indain Ocean, the Darling ranges and the Swan and Canning Rivers. A cosmopolitan city which offers a wide range of cuisine, especially the most wonderful seafood, numerous nightspots, parks, pristine beaches and plenty of water ways for water and other outside activities. Perth is 3 hours drive from the well known Margaret River wineries and beaches, 30 mins from the Swan Valley wineries and other tourist attractions.
Perth / Kinross area
Kinross, Western Australia Kinross is a small suburb in the city of Joondalup filled with young families and popular with overseas migrants. The gentle, community feel and proximity to local beaches make it a great place to raise a family. As a result, a healthy mix of Asian, British, South African and European families occupy the suburb alongside the local population. Being close to the coast also means good sea breezes to cool down hot summer evenings. Kinross is a green suburb, with parks aplenty. Spaced out within the suburb are Callender Park, McNaughton Park, Stonehaven Park, Falklands Park and Roxburgh Park.
If you have not already guessed, the Scottish influence in Kinross is not limited to its name but extends throughout the suburb with road names mainly derived from Scottish place names, for example Glencoe Loop, Edinburgh Avenue, Selkirk Drive, Falkirk Court, you get the gist of it.
Kinross has a Primary and Middle School and local shops. Kinross Primary School was opened in 1995, and Kinross College was opened in 2002. Kinross is bordered by Joondalup, Currambine, Burns and Clarkson. It also has its own Football (Soccer) Club which plays its home matches at the McNaughton Park ground.
Kinross currently has one suburban shopping centre, located along Kinross Drive, with a new shopping centre on the corner of Connolly and Selkirk Drives currently under development.
Kinross ranges from a 40 min drive to Perth, to a 5 min walk to Currambine Train station with direct trains to Perth.
